How much do excavator subcontractor j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for excavator subcontractor in the United States is $26.16,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$21.63 and $28.61 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are common challenges faced by excavator subcontractors on construction sites?

Excavator Subcontractors often encounter challenges such as working with unexpected ground conditions, adhering to tight project timelines, and coordinating with multiple contractors on busy job sites. Navigating underground utilities or weather-related delays can require quick problem-solving and adaptability. Effective communication with project managers, site supervisors, and other subcontractors is essential to ensure that excavation tasks align with the broader construction schedule. Overcoming these challenges successfully helps maintain project efficiency and safety, making an Excavator Subcontractor a valuable asset to any construction team.

What is an excavator subcontractor?

An Excavator Subcontractor is a specialized contractor hired to perform excavation work on construction projects. They operate heavy machinery to dig, move, and shape the earth for foundations, utilities, roads, and other structures. Typically, they work under a general contractor or project manager and must follow site plans, safety regulations, and project timelines. Their responsibilities may also include site preparation, trenching, grading, and ensuring proper disposal of excavated materials. Skilled Excavator Subcontractors have experience handling various types of terrain and soil conditions to complete projects efficiently and safely.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as an excavator subcontractor?

To thrive as an Excavator Subcontractor, you need extensive experience in heavy equipment operation, knowledge of excavation and grading techniques, and familiarity with construction safety standards. Proficiency with various types of excavators, site plans, and possibly OSHA certification or a Commercial Driver’s License (CDL) are commonly required. Strong communication, problem-solving abilities, and attention to detail set outstanding subcontractors apart. These competencies are critical for ensuring safe, efficient, and high-quality excavation work that meets project specifications and deadlines.
